Core Functions of UTM Systems
Fundamental Material Evaluation
Tensile Testing: Measures yield strength, elongation and break points (e.g. metal wires, polymer films)
Compression Testing: Assesses crush resistance (e.g. concrete blocks, battery components)
Flexural Testing: Determines bending stiffness (e.g. photovoltaic panel frames)
Advanced Structural Analysis
Peel strength tests for adhesives
Shear resistance evaluation for fasteners
Cyclic loading simulations for fatigue life prediction
Key Industries Served
New Energy: Validating solar connector durability under extreme weather simulation
Automotive: Testing seatbelt tensile strength and component fatigue resistance
Construction: Certifying steel reinforcement bars to GB/T 228.1 standards
Electronics: Measuring flexible PCB substrate deformation limits
